The paper proposes FrameFT, a parameter-efficient fine-tuning method using sparse coefficients in a Fusion Frame basis, reducing memory footprint while achieving performance on par with or exceeding state-of-the-art PEFT techniques.
LongAct proposes a saliency-guided sparse update strategy for improving long-context reasoning in LLMs by selectively updating weights associated with high-magnitude activations in query and key vectors, achieving ~8% improvement on LongBench v2.
